Doctor Who confirms same-sex relationship between Yaz and The Doctor

Doctor Who just got a lot more sapphic thanks to the latest episode’s confirmation that The Doctor (Jodie Whittaker) and Yaz (Mandip Gill) have romantic feelings for one another.

The relationship between The Doctor and Yaz has always been a favourite in the Doctor Who fandom ever since Yaz and The Doctor first met in Jodie Whittaker’s first season as the enigmatic Time Lord. This was to be somewhat expected since this was the first time that The Doctor was portrayed by a female actor and the alien has had romantic feelings for his companions in the past (e.g Rose Tyler being a prominent example, as well as their wife, River Song). So why not ship The Doctor with a female companion, in spite of their female form, right?

However, the ship of Yaz and The Doctor (also known as Thasmin by the couple’s fans) has moved beyond fanon to canon territory thanks to the latest Doctor Who episode ‘Eve of the Daleks’.

In ‘Eve of the Daleks’, The Doctor, Yaz and LGBTQ+ ally of the year, Dan (John Bishop), are stuck in a time loop. The downside of that is that there’s a team of Executioner Daleks trailing behind them, wanting to exterminate them to smithereens for the Doctor’s actions while fighting The Flux. As you might expect, it’s a stressful time for the three of them and there’s an uncomfortable tension as The Doctor tries to figure out a way to survive.

It’s during a tense moment where Dan takes notice of the fact that Yaz has some pretty obvious romantic feelings for the Time Lord and points it out. While it’s not confirmed what those ‘feelings’ are, it’s obvious in the way Yaz responds about how she’s not told anyone about how she feels, including herself, that the romantic subtext that has followed The Doctor and Yaz’s relationship throughout the series has now been thrown out of the window.

It’s not been confirmed whether The Doctor feels the same way about her companion, but there’s no denying that they at least know of Yaz’s feelings thanks to Dan explicitly telling the Time Lord in ‘Eve of the Daleks’.

“She likes you,” Dan tells The Doctor to which she replies that she likes Yaz also.

“No, I mean she likes you.” Dan reiterates. Again, The Doctor pretends not to understand what her companion is talking about, but it’s made pretty clear later on in that same scene that the Time Lord knows exactly what Dan means.

Doctor Who has never shied away from LGBTQ+ representation, even before it broke boundaries to see the 9th Doctor kiss Jack Harkness back in 2005. There have been several queer characters as the modern series has developed, including Madame Vastra and Jenny, 12th Doctor companion Bill Potts and even The Doctor’s wife, River Song, still considering The Thirteenth Doctor her spouse after encountering her in the short story, The Guide to the Dark Times.

Even so, the confirmation that Yaz has feelings for The Doctor is a major victory for some fans who feel that the ‘coming out’ scene in the latest episode could really help LGBTQ+ fans of the sci-fi show.
